About us
We are excited to appoint a Breakfast Provision Supervisor to join the team at Dinas Powys Primary School. We are a thriving primary school providing for 450 pupils aged 3–11 across two sites in Dinas Powys. Our pupils are enthusiastic and curious, creating a warm and welcoming atmosphere each morning, and they thrive on the positive relationships and routines that the breakfast provision supports. In return, we are able to offer a supportive, vibrant team environment.

About the role
Pay Details: Grade 1, Scale Point 2, actual salary £2827 per annum.
Hours of Work / Weeks per year / Working Pattern:1 hour per day totalling 5 hours per week, term time for 38 weeks per year, 7.50am to 8.50am
Main Place of Work:The role is based at the junior site but it is expected that the successful candidate will be able to work at either site as required.
Description: The successful candidate will be responsible for supporting the delivery of Welsh Government’s free breakfast provision. This will include setting up and cleaning away as well as ensuring the children are cared for and well looked after.
About you
You will need:
The successful candidate will be a warm, reliable and proactive individual who enjoys working with young children and helping them start their day positively. They will demonstrate strong communication skills, the ability to build nurturing relationships, and the confidence to support pupils aged 3–11 in a busy, welcoming environment. A commitment to safeguarding, promoting positive behaviour, and maintaining a safe, well‑organised breakfast provision is essential. Flexibility, teamwork, and a calm, friendly approach are key qualities for this role.
EWC Required: No
DBS Check Required: Enhanced with child barring list check
